Merge tag 'kvm-ppc-next-5.1-1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/paulus/powerpc into kvm-next
PPC KVM update for 5.1 There are no major new features this time, just a collection of bug fixes and improvements in various areas, including machine check handling and context switching of protection-key-related registers.
